Thousands over the years have had "good luck" with AACA Library & Research Center automotive info request forms. Your L&RC retains an enormous amount of literature for research.

If you are a member of the AACA you receive 1 1/2 hours of free research time per year. If not the research fees are nominal and very well worth the fee.

Research Request Form

In order to identify your vehicle with certainty, please fill in the form below as completely as possible. We will search our collection and send you an e-mail containing a list of the available information and the applicable duplication fees. You may then decide which items to order. Research requests may take 4-6 weeks to process. Duplication requests are fulfilled via the US Postal Service only.

Because we are a nonprofit corporation, our archival information and research services must be self-supporting. The following schedule reflects our fees in time and materials to fulfill your request. Please note, the processing fee must accompany this request form and be in US Dollars. We accept: major credit cards, PayPal, and checks made payable to the AACA Library.

Rattiac (and other curious readers),

The process to request information form the library is really quite painless. Once you submit the form, I do the research and will send you an order list that you can use to request copies.

A typical request would be something like "What information do you have on a 1932 Pontiac?" I would reply with a list containing things like sales catalogs, wiring diagrams, paint chips, misc. pictures, and magazine articles. Copies are $0.30/page for B&W, and $0.50/page for color. We also offer digital scans for $1.00/page.

As Peter mentioned, AACA members receive 1.5 hours of free research every year. Non-members pay $30/hr. Everyone pays the $10 processing fee. If you are able to visit us in Hershey all on-site research is free, you just pay for the copies or scans.

While I can appreciate your nervousness about internet transactions, I can assure you that we are a very professional & efficient organization.

The address for the library is 501 West Governor Rd., Hershey, PA 17033. Visit our website at AACA Library.
